  • European carmaker Stellantis will this week hold talks over the fate of its Vauxhall plant in northern England, a source close to the matter told AFP Monday, confirming media reports. The source added however that it remains unclear whether Stellantis will reach a decision yet over the factory, which is located in Ellesmere Port, on the northwest English coast. Stellantis will discuss the facility in the context of the overall demand outlook, the ongoing transition to electric vehicles and the likelihood of UK government financial support, according to the source. The Times newspaper meanwhile reported that top executives could meet as early as Tuesday to discuss production options including closure. Bosses will also decide whether to manufacture the latest Vauxhall Astra model at the plant or shift manufacturing elsewhere. "The group is considering its investment options" over Ellesmere Port, a Stellantis spokesman said separately on Monday. "A decision will be made shortly," he added. A British government spokesman told AFP that it spoke regularly with all automotive companies including Stellantis, but would not comment on media speculation. Stellantis Chief Executive Carlos Tavares had meanwhile indicated one month ago that it would make decisions within weeks over its future investments in Britain. The giant was created from the merger of French giant PSA -- and its Peugeot and Citroen brands -- with the Italian carmaker Fiat, which also owns Chrysler, Jeep, Alfa Romeo and Maserati, among others. The blockbuster merger, completed in January, created the world's fourth biggest carmaker by volume.
